一、引言
随着互联网的快速发展,电子商务已成为人们购物的主要方式之一。商城系统的安全性和性能直接关系到用户的购物体验和商家的利益。其中,CC攻击(Challenge Collapsar)是一种常见的网络攻击手段,它通过大量无效的请求来占用服务器资源,导致正常用户无法访问商城系统,从而造成巨大损失。同时,商城系统的打开速度也是影响用户体验的关键因素之一。因此,如何应对CC攻击和提高商城系统的打开速度,成为了电商平台必须面对的问题。本文将围绕这一问题进行详细的阐述,并分享一些实用的方法和技巧。
二、CC攻击的概述
CC攻击是一种基于HTTP协议的攻击手段,它通过发送大量的无效请求来消耗服务器的资源,导致服务器无法处理正常的请求。CC攻击的特点是流量大、请求频繁且无效,使得服务器在处理这些请求时消耗大量的CPU、内存和网络带宽等资源,最终导致服务器瘫痪或响应缓慢。
三、CC攻击的危害
CC攻击对商城系统造成的危害是巨大的。首先,攻击者通过大量的无效请求占用了服务器的资源,导致正常用户无法访问商城系统,造成用户体验下降。其次,CC攻击还可能导致服务器瘫痪或崩溃,使得商城系统长时间无法访问,影响商家的正常运营和用户的购物体验。此外,CC攻击还可能被用于恶意竞争、敲诈勒索等非法活动,给商家带来巨大的经济损失和声誉损害。
四、如何应对CC攻击
1. 防火墙策略:设置防火墙规则,过滤掉来自特定IP或地区的无效请求。同时,配置防火墙的访问控制策略,只允许合法的IP地址访问商城系统。
2. 验证码验证:在用户提交表单或进行关键操作时,添加验证码验证功能,防止恶意机器人发送大量无效请求。
3. 限制访问频率:对同一IP地址的访问频率进行限制,防止短时间内大量的无效请求。
4. 负载均衡:通过负载均衡技术将流量分散到多个服务器上,降低单台服务器的负载压力。
5. 实时监控与报警:建立实时监控系统,对商城系统的流量、访问频率等进行实时监控。一旦发现异常情况,立即启动报警机制并采取相应措施。
6. 定期更新和打补丁:定期对商城系统进行更新和打补丁,修复已知的安全漏洞和隐患。
五、提升商城系统打开速度的方法与技巧
1. 优化图片和文件:压缩图片和文件大小,减少加载时间。同时,使用CDN(Content Delivery Network)技术将图片和文件存储在离用户更近的节点上,提高访问速度。
2. 数据库优化:对数据库进行优化,包括索引优化、查询优化等,提高数据库的查询速度和响应速度。
3. 缓存技术:使用缓存技术如Redis或Memcached等来缓存数据和页面内容,减少数据库的访问次数和页面重新渲染的时间。
4. 服务器优化:对服务器进行硬件升级或配置优化等操作来提高服务器的性能和处理能力。
5. 前端性能优化:优化前端代码和资源加载速度等来提高页面加载速度和用户体验。例如减少HTTP请求次数、使用异步加载等技术手段。
6. 网络环境优化:对网络环境进行优化以提高网络传输速度和稳定性等指标也是提高商城系统打开速度的重要手段之一。例如使用CDN加速技术来提高网络传输速度等。
六、结论
本文围绕“商城系统安全:如何应对CC攻击与提升打开速度”这一主题进行了详细的阐述和分析。首先介绍了CC攻击的概念和危害性;然后提出了应对CC攻击的策略和方法;最后分享了提高商城系统打开速度的方法与技巧。在实际应用中,我们应该根据自身的情况选择合适的策略和方法来应对CC攻击和提高商城系统的性能和安全性能保护自身利益不受损害同时也保护用户购物体验不再受到困扰最后需要指出的是以上提到的技巧并不是一成不变的随着技术和攻击手段的发展我们也需要不断地学习和更新知识以应对不断变化的挑战和问题在本文的最后一行关键词为“商城系统安全”、“CC攻击”、“打开速度”。这些关键词贯穿了整篇文章的主题和内容希望能够帮助读者更好地理解和掌握文章所传达的信息和观点。







